Name             : David Finkle
   
   
David Finkle...Nationally renowned traditional drummaker, award winning multi-instrumental recording artist, music producer and highly sought after project facilitator. His workshops include drum and/or rattle making, exploring hand drumming techniques and finally world musical instrument demonstrations. The latter concentrating on non-electric indigenous instruments from differing cultures the world over. As well as having completed soundtracks for many extremely successful theatrical productions, his list of past performances is impressive and ever growing. David has performed at such well established venues as The National Arts Centre, The Ottawa Folk Festival, The Parliament Buildings (for the senate), Colonel By Festival, Pinheys Point Heritage Festival, The Wakefield Harvest Festival, The Black Sheep Inn, The Ottawa Fringe Festival, The Loyalist College Festival of Native Arts, Southam Hall, Grant Hall, The Empire Theatre and other high profile locations and events too numerous to mention here. A past winner at The Canadian Aboriginal Music Awards in 2003 for Best Instrumental Album entitled Natural Resources (co-written with David Maracle) he has been featured on a number of Television and Radio shows, and been written about in many a magazine and/or newspapers. A full-time dad to his nine year old daughter Aurora (a jingle dress dancer), he is also a native craft vendor and they can both be seen frequenting the local pow-wows and even performing together (Aurora plays drum!) at various events.
